About

Thomas Alan Rouse is a corporate and incorporation attorney with over 50 years of legal experience, practicing at Thomas A. Rouse in Plainville, CT. He earned a J.D. from University of Connecticut. He has been admitted to the Connecticut Bar since 1975. His practice encompasses corporate and incorporation, energy and utilities, intellectual property, licensing, and telecommunications, allowing him to serve clients across a range of legal needs. He maintains a clean professional disciplinary record.
